Malaysia exports of Crustaceans; crabs, frozen (whether in shell or not, whether or not cooked by steaming or by boiling in water) was $5,090.49K and quantity 683,553Kg.
Malaysia exported Crustaceans; crabs, frozen (whether in shell or not, whether or not cooked by steaming or by boiling in water) to Singapore ($4,898.75K , 628,667 Kg), Brunei ($112.78K , 20,790 Kg), Thailand ($70.72K , 31,175 Kg), Other Asia, nes ($5.77K , 2,621 Kg), China ($2.46K , 300 Kg).
